Output d26cab741596d871c1066add215734c23d67891768c4c2fe151c39f9b70e8644:1

value
7843300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78147abe47c80cd944395edc0900e4e3f8e8a48d OP_EQUAL
address
3CdwYW3nRvrkrwJGwaNToTtS9XSosoKppk
transaction
d26cab741596d871c1066add215734c23d67891768c4c2fe151c39f9b70e8644
confirmations
472890
spent
true